Government Records Stay With Custodians
No government record, court file, vital certificate, property roll, or voter file is hosted by California People Search. Those items remain with state agencies, county recorders or clerk-recorders, assessors, superior courts, and other official custodians. Requests to obtain, verify, correct, seal, or remove a record must go to the office that maintains it. General agency access may fall under the California Public Records Act, Government Code ยง 7920.000 et seq., while court, vital, voter, and protected records follow additional rules.
